Job description

Job Summary:

Leads the end‑to‑end planning pipeline for asset‑related work by scoping, validating, and prioritizing corrective, preventive, and capital activities. Ensures Operations receives the right work at the right time by aligning all plans with risk‑based priorities established by Asset Strategy.

Job Description:
  • Controls corrective, preventive, and improvement task inventories while ensuring field readiness -including materials, access conditions, and asset status- and confirming PM/CM programs reflect Asset Strategy–defined test and inspection frequencies.
  • Guides the conversion of long‑term asset class strategies into actionable, risk‑aligned work scopes and ensures only validated, prioritized work is delivered to Operations with proper sequencing and readiness.
  • Evaluates the risk‑based investment and work prioritization framework, translating mitigation decisions into executable annual and quarterly work plans while maintaining alignment with LTIP governance and capital investment processes.
  • Communicates clear visibility into work pipelines, readiness, prioritization drivers, and schedule adherence while coordinating PREB reporting, LTIP inputs, and maintenance program performance reviews to support governance and strengthen execution outcomes.
  • Coordinates with Operations and Engineering to properly sequence and resource scheduled work, monitor permits, materials, and design‑package barriers, **escalate** issues as needed, and track execution performance to identify systemic obstacles.
  • Leads, models and ensures consistent application of policies and regulatory standards across teams to support ethical operations and mitigate compliance risks.
  • Leads and validates the planning and execution of restoration and emergency preparedness activities to strengthen operational resilience and response capacity.
  • Assumes and oversees expanded duties aligned with organizational priorities and professional scope to drive departmental effectiveness and strategic alignment.
